The160-page high-end book, The Art of Tron: Legacy takes fans inside the art and design of the upcoming film Tron: Legacy. The book will showcase beautiful concept illustrations, set designs, character bios, images from the film, and an afterword by the film’s director, Joseph Kosinski. The landscape trim format, striking jacket image and a color treatment made specifically to bring the world of Tron to life, make this stunning addition to anyone’s collection.

The Art of Tron: Legacy is more of a visual companion than an art book. Whenever there's "art of" somewhere in the book title, it sets people up with certain expectations. This title definitely sets up the wrong type of expectation, at least to me.

About half the book is concept art and the other half is just film stills, and even if it's not exactly half, it feels that way.

Much of the concept art are actually the finalized designs. You won't see much iterations. It's like they nailed the design of the Light Cycle bike with the first try. Same applies for characters and environments. And the Light Jets are missing.

The selection of films stills included is also questionable, but I'm glad for the most part they look stunning visually, especially the ones that are showing more of the Tron world.

This book should still appeal to Tron fans. I'm not so hot about the book, but I've two colleages (fans of the film) raves about it.

As an art book, I'll give it 3 stars. As a visual companion or picture book, 4 out of 5 stars.

it looks great and since I got it on sale I'm not even really annoyed about it. But people buying this full price may feel a little ripped off or mislead.
If you're looking for a book full of designs, conceptual design and sketches... it's about 30-40% of the book. The rest of the images are nothing but still images of the final movie. Just pictures of stuff you're already going to see when you watch it.

Like I said, great book, great movie but I expected a lot more out of an "art" book.

The design work for T:L is impressive, but unfortunately very little of the concept design work leading up to the final product is in this. Almost all of the art appears to be the final approved pre-vis, but not the development sketches or alternate ideas.

Moreover, my favorite moments in the movie involve the fantastic light jets and light flyer at the end, but there is not a single sketch or screen shot of them. Seriously, I was flipping eagerly to the back of the book looking for them, and even checked the table of contents to see if maybe I had missed it, or the book was missing a section. Disappointing.
